css导航条怎么设置 路飞SEO • 2025-06-11 05:19 • 网站建设 • 1 views 要设置CSS导航条,首先创建HTML结构,使用` `标签包裹导航链接。接着在CSS中,使用`display: flex;`实现水平布局,`justify-content: space-around;`均匀分布链接。通过`background-color`和`color`属性设置背景和文字颜色。最后,使用`:hover`伪类添加鼠标悬停效果,提升用户体验。 source from: pexels 目录 CSS导航条:网页设计的点睛之笔一、创建HTML结构1、使用 标签包裹导航链接2、定义导航链接的HTML代码二、CSS基础设置1、使用display: flex;实现水平布局2、通过justify-content: space-around;均匀分布链接三、样式美化1. 设置背景颜色 background-color2. 设置文字颜色 color3. 添加边框和圆角效果四、交互效果提升1、使用:hover伪类添加鼠标悬停效果2、实现动态过渡效果transition结语:打造高效美观的CSS导航条常见问题1、如何解决导航条在不同浏览器中的兼容性问题?2、导航条响应式设计需要注意哪些方面?3、如何通过CSS实现二级导航菜单? CSS导航条:网页设计的点睛之笔 在现代网页设计中,CSS导航条不仅是一个不可或缺的元素,更是提升用户体验和页面美观度的关键所在。一个设计精良的导航条,能够清晰展示网站结构,引导用户快速找到所需内容。其基本构成通常包括HTML结构的搭建和CSS样式的应用。常见的应用场景涵盖了企业官网、电商平台、个人博客等各类网站。通过巧妙设置CSS属性,如display: flex;实现水平布局,justify-content: space-around;均匀分布链接,以及利用:hover伪类添加鼠标悬停效果,可以让导航条既实用又美观。你是否也对如何打造一个高效、美观的CSS导航条充满好奇?接下来,让我们一起探索其中的奥秘。 一、创建HTML结构 在构建一个高效的CSS导航条之前,首先需要打好HTML结构的基础。HTML结构是导航条的骨架,决定了导航条的基本布局和功能。以下是创建HTML结构的两个关键步骤: 1、使用 标签包裹导航链接 标签是HTML5中新增的语义化标签,专门用于定义页面中的导航链接部分。使用 标签不仅可以提升代码的可读性,还能让搜索引擎更好地理解页面结构。例如: 首页 关于我们 服务 联系我们 通过这种方式,我们清晰地定义了导航条的基本框架。 2、定义导航链接的HTML代码 在 标签内部,通常使用无序列表 和列表项 来组织导航链接。每个列表项内包含一个标签,用于定义具体的导航链接。例如: 首页 关于我们 服务 联系我们 这种方式不仅结构清晰,还便于后续通过CSS进行样式控制。通过合理使用 、 和 标签,我们为导航条打下了坚实的HTML基础,为后续的CSS样式应用奠定了良好的基础。 在创建HTML结构时,务必注意标签的语义化和结构的简洁性,这将直接影响到导航条的可维护性和搜索引擎的友好度。通过以上两步,我们成功地为CSS导航条搭建了一个稳固的HTML框架。 二、CSS基础设置 在完成了HTML结构的搭建后,接下来我们将进入CSS基础设置的环节。这一步是打造高效美观CSS导航条的关键所在。 1、使用display: flex;实现水平布局 首先,我们需要将导航条中的链接水平排列。为此,可以使用CSS中的display: flex;属性。这一属性能够将导航条的容器变为一个弹性盒子,使得其中的子元素(即导航链接)自动水平排列。具体代码如下: nav { display: flex;} 通过这种方式,导航链接将均匀地分布在导航条中,避免了手动调整间距的繁琐过程。 2、通过justify-content: space-around;均匀分布链接 为了让导航链接在导航条中更加均匀地分布,我们可以使用justify-content: space-around;属性。这个属性会自动计算并分配每个链接之间的空间,使得整个导航条看起来更加整洁和美观。代码示例如下: nav { display: flex; justify-content: space-around;} 这样一来,无论导航条有多宽,链接都会自动调整间距,保持整体的和谐与平衡。 通过以上两步的基础设置,我们的CSS导航条已经具备了基本的布局和分布效果。接下来,我们将在后续章节中进一步探讨如何通过样式美化和交互效果提升,使得导航条更加吸引人和易用。 三、样式美化 在完成了基本的HTML结构和CSS布局后,接下来我们将深入探讨如何通过样式美化来提升CSS导航条的美观度和用户体验。这一步骤是打造高效美观导航条的关键环节。 1. 设置背景颜色 background-color 背景颜色是导航条设计中的基础元素,直接影响整体视觉效果。选择合适的背景颜色不仅能增强导航条的辨识度,还能与网页整体风格相协调。例如,使用深色背景搭配浅色文字,可以营造出高端、专业的氛围。具体代码如下: nav { background-color: #333; /* 深灰色背景 */} 2. 设置文字颜色 color 文字颜色同样重要,它直接影响到用户的阅读体验。一般来说,文字颜色应与背景颜色形成鲜明对比,以确保文字清晰可读。假设我们选择白色文字,代码如下: nav a { color: #fff; /* 白色文字 */} 3. 添加边框和圆角效果 边框和圆角效果可以增加导航条的层次感和设计感。通过border属性添加边框,并使用border-radius属性设置圆角,可以使导航条看起来更加柔和、现代。例如: nav { border: 1px solid #444; /* 深灰色边框 */ border-radius: 8px; /* 圆角效果 */} 此外,为了进一步提升视觉效果,可以考虑为导航链接添加阴影效果,使用box-shadow属性来实现: nav a { box-shadow: 0 2px 4px rgba(0, 0, 0, 0.2); /* 添加阴影 */} 通过以上步骤,我们不仅美化了导航条的样式,还增强了其视觉效果和用户体验。每一个细节的调整都旨在打造一个既美观又实用的CSS导航条。记住,优秀的导航条设计不仅能吸引用户的注意力,还能提升网站的整体品质。 四、交互效果提升 在完成了CSS导航条的基本结构和样式美化后,提升交互效果是关键的一步。交互效果的优化不仅能增强用户体验,还能使导航条更加生动和吸引人。 1、使用:hover伪类添加鼠标悬停效果 :hover伪类是CSS中常用的一种选择器,用于当鼠标悬停在元素上时改变其样式。对于导航条来说,添加鼠标悬停效果可以显著提升用户的交互体验。以下是一个简单的示例代码: nav a:hover { color: #ff4500; /* 悬停时文字颜色变为橙色 */ background-color: #f0f0f0; /* 悬停时背景颜色变为浅灰色 */} 通过这种方式,当用户将鼠标悬停在导航链接上时,链接的颜色和背景色会发生改变,从而提供视觉反馈,吸引用户点击。 2、实现动态过渡效果transition 除了鼠标悬停效果,动态过渡效果也是提升交互体验的重要手段。transition属性可以让元素的样式变化更加平滑和自然。以下是如何在导航条中应用transition的示例: nav a { transition: color 0.3s ease, background-color 0.3s ease; /* 设置颜色和背景色的过渡效果 */}nav a:hover { color: #ff4500; background-color: #f0f0f0;} 在这个示例中,transition属性设置了颜色和背景色变化的过渡时间为0.3秒,并且使用ease函数使过渡效果更加自然。这样,当用户将鼠标悬停在链接上时,颜色和背景色的变化不会瞬间完成,而是有一个平滑的过渡过程,从而提升视觉效果。 通过以上两种方法的结合,我们可以打造一个既有视觉吸引力又具备良好交互性的CSS导航条。这不仅能让用户在使用过程中感受到更多的乐趣,还能有效提升网页的整体品质。 需要注意的是,交互效果的设置应适度,避免过度炫目,以免分散用户的注意力。合理的交互设计应注重实用性和美观性的平衡,确保导航条在提升用户体验的同时,不会影响其基本功能的发挥。 综上所述,通过巧妙运用:hover伪类和transition属性,我们可以显著提升CSS导航条的交互效果,使其在网页设计中发挥更大的作用。 结语:打造高效美观的CSS导航条 通过上述步骤,我们已经掌握了CSS导航条设置的核心技巧。首先,通过创建HTML结构,使用 标签为导航链接提供语义化的包裹。接着,在CSS基础设置中,利用display: flex;实现水平布局,并通过justify-content: space-around;确保链接均匀分布。在样式美化环节,通过background-color和color属性定制背景和文字颜色,再辅以边框和圆角效果,提升视觉美感。最后,通过:hover伪类和transition属性,添加鼠标悬停的动态效果,增强用户交互体验。 CSS导航条不仅在提升网页美观度上扮演重要角色,更是优化用户体验的关键因素。一个高效美观的导航条,能够显著提高用户的浏览效率和满意度。因此,鼓励大家在实践中不断优化和创新,打造出符合自身网站风格的导航条设计。记住,细节决定成败,每一个小改动都可能带来意想不到的惊喜效果。 常见问题 1、如何解决导航条在不同浏览器中的兼容性问题? 在设置CSS导航条时,不同浏览器的兼容性问题常常让人头疼。首先,确保使用标准的HTML和CSS代码,避免使用过于特殊的属性。其次,利用CSS前缀如-webkit-、-moz-、-ms-和-o-来兼容不同内核的浏览器。例如,使用transition属性时,可以写成: transition: all 0.3s ease;-webkit-transition: all 0.3s ease;-moz-transition: all 0.3s ease;-ms-transition: all 0.3s ease;-o-transition: all 0.3s ease; 此外,使用工具如Autoprefixer可以自动添加这些前缀,简化工作流程。 2、导航条响应式设计需要注意哪些方面? 响应式设计是现代网页设计的核心。首先,使用媒体查询(Media Queries)来根据不同屏幕尺寸调整导航条的布局和样式。例如: @media (max-width: 768px) { nav { flex-direction: column; }} 其次,考虑使用折叠菜单(如汉堡菜单)在小屏幕上节省空间。还可以通过JavaScript动态调整导航条的显示状态。确保所有链接在触摸屏设备上易于点击,避免过小的点击区域。 3、如何通过CSS实现二级导航菜单? 二级导航菜单可以让网站结构更清晰。首先,在HTML中嵌套 和 标签来创建二级菜单: 首页 子页面1 子页面2 然后在CSS中,使用position: relative;和position: absolute;来定位二级菜单: nav ul li { position: relative;}nav ul li ul { position: absolute; display: none;}nav ul li:hover ul { display: block;} 通过display: none;和display: block;控制二级菜单的显示和隐藏,结合:hover伪类实现鼠标悬停时的展开效果。这样,一个简洁且功能完备的二级导航菜单就完成了。 原创文章,作者:路飞SEO,如若转载,请注明出处:https://www.shuziqianzhan.com/article/54947.html Like (0) 路飞SEO编辑 0 0 Generate poster 织梦怎么调用文章页 Previous 2025-06-11 05:19 网络技术怎么设计软件 Next 2025-06-11 05:19 相关推荐 网站建设 什么系统定制开发 系统定制开发是指根据企业或个人特定需求,量身打造的软件系统解决方案。它不同于通用软件,能精准解决业务痛点,提升效率。定制开发涉及需求分析、设计、编码、测试等环节,确保系统与业务流程高度契合,适用于金融、医疗、电商等行业。 路飞练拳的地方 2025-06-08 002 网站建设 网页字体什么字体好 选择网页字体时,优先考虑易读性和兼容性。推荐使用Arial、Helvetica和Verdana等常见无衬线字体,它们在多数设备和浏览器上显示效果良好,用户体验佳。此外,Google Fonts提供的Open Sans和Roboto也是不错的选择,既现代又易于阅读。 路飞SEO 2025-06-20 00191 网站建设 如何登陆公司后台 要登陆公司后台,首先打开公司官网,找到后台登陆入口。输入你的用户名和密码,点击登陆按钮。如果忘记密码,可点击‘忘记密码’进行重置。确保网络连接稳定,使用公司指定的浏览器以获得最佳体验。 路飞SEO 2025-06-12 00404 网站建设 英文网站制作多少钱 制作英文网站的成本因多种因素而异,包括设计复杂度、功能需求、内容量和开发团队水平。基础版英文网站约需5000-10000元,中等复杂度网站需10000-30000元,高端定制网站则可能超过50000元。建议明确需求后咨询专业团队获取精准报价。 路飞SEO 2025-06-11 003 网站建设 页面中怎么制作曲线 要在页面中制作曲线,首先选择合适的工具,如CSS的`border-radius`属性或SVG标签。使用CSS时,通过调整`border-radius`的值来创建圆角矩形,进一步结合`transform`属性实现更复杂的曲线效果。SVG则提供了``标签,通过定义贝塞尔曲线等路径指令,绘制任意形状的曲线。确保代码简洁且响应式,以提升页面加载速度和用户体验。 路飞SEO 2025-06-11 000 网站建设 如何设计登录页面 设计登录页面时,首要考虑用户体验,简洁的界面能减少用户操作负担。使用清晰的表单字段,提供明确的提示信息,确保输入框易于识别。配色应和谐,避免视觉疲劳。加入品牌元素提升信任感,同时确保页面加载速度。利用SEO优化关键词,如'用户登录'、'快速注册',提高页面搜索排名。 路飞练拳的地方 2025-06-09 000 网站建设 ps怎么把图片变成冰霜的效果 要将图片变成冰霜效果,首先在Photoshop中打开图片,创建新图层并填充白色。然后应用“杂色”滤镜,选择“添加杂色”,调整数量至合适值。接着使用“动感模糊”滤镜,设置角度和距离模拟冰霜纹理。最后,调整图层混合模式为“叠加”或“柔光”,调整不透明度,使冰霜效果自然融合。根据需要,可用蒙版工具细化冰霜区域。 路飞SEO 2025-06-16 00192 网站建设 如何查看域名的备案信息 要查看域名的备案信息,首先访问中国工业和信息化部网站,点击“ICP/IP地址/域名信息备案管理系统”。输入要查询的域名,系统会显示该域名的备案号、主办单位名称、网站备案/许可证号等信息。确保域名已备案,避免违规风险。 路飞SEO 2025-06-14 00122 网站建设 kuh有哪些英文词 Kuh 在德语中意为“牛”,对应的英文词是“cow”。此外,kuh 还可以引申为“母牛”或“奶牛”。了解这些词汇有助于在农业、畜牧业等相关领域的英文交流中更准确表达。 路飞SEO 2025-06-15 00111 发表回复 您的邮箱地址不会被公开。 必填项已用 * 标注*Name: *Email: Website: Save my name, email, and website in this browser for the next time I comment. Submit Δ